The ingredients needed to make Pilau kachumbari:
  1. Prepare pishori rice
  2. Take beef
  3. Take Grinded pilau masala
  4. Prepare garlic onion
  5. Get Ginger
  6. Take large sized onions
  7. Make ready large ripe tomatoes
  8. Get Salt
  9. Get Cooking oil

Kachumbari is Kenyan onion and tomato salad. It is a very simple salad which you can whip up in no time with simple ingredients. Serve with Pilau (East African one-pot rice dish) for an awesome dining. We made this as a side for Anina's Kenyan Pilau and ended up mixing it into the finished dish.

Instructions to make Pilau kachumbari:
  1. Cut the beef into pieces and boil for 15 minutes to soften soak the grinded pilau masala by adding a little drops of water. Boil 8 cups of water.
  2. Cut your onions and tomatoes into small size,grind the garlic and ginger. Into a dry sufuria, add half a quarter litre of cooking oil and heat for a while, deep the onions and fry till golden brown.
  3. Then add the grinded garlic and ginger and fry till the mixture becomes brown
  4. Then add the tomatoes and spoonful salt and fry till they form a thick soup. Now add your soaked pilau masala and stir to mix. Fry till the water evaporates.
  5. Next add the boiled meat and stir to mix well, then add the rice and stir also to mix.
  6. Then add Four half litre cups of hot water and continue stirring as it cook. Moderate the amount of heat slowly by slowly till the water evaporates. Use aluminium foil to cover the sufuria so as to dry well.now cool the pilau and serve with kachumbari.
